Earth Matters : How Soil Underlies Civilization Richard D. Bardgett - 1st - Oxford Oxford University Press 2016 - xviii,191 Pages 22x14 cm HB
Include Illustration, Notes and Index
Earth Matters describes the importance of soil, the many ways in which we depend on it, and how humans have worked with the soil throughout history. Exploring the reasons for increasing recognition and respect for soil even among town and city dwellers, Bardgett concludes with a look at current efforts to stop widespread soil degradation
